Jokowi & Infrastructure Development Post-Election

As predicted, President Joko “Jokowi” Widodo is prioritizing the acceleration of infrastructure development in the provinces that hugely contributed to his victory in the 2019 presidential race. The President was in a work visit in East Java yesterday (June 20). He distributed 3,200 free land certificates to the local residents of East Java in a ceremony event held at the Tri Dharma Sport Center (GOR) in Gresik. Governor of East Java Khofifah Indar Parawansa, Regent of Gresik Sambari Halim Radianto, and some cabinet members were also present in the event.

Jokowi’s Son-in-Law & PSSI Congress

Bobby Afif Nasution, the son-in-law of President Joko “Jokowi” Widodo, is in the spotlight following the rumor saying that he will serve as the secretary general of the Indonesian Football Association (PSSI) should Police Comr. Gen. Mochammad Iriawan become the new chairman of the association. Mochammad Iriawan a.k.a Iwan Bule is one of the strongest candidates to compete in the upcoming extraordinary chairmanship congress (KLB) of PSSI next month.
